Flavonoids for reduction of atherosclerotic risk
Current Atherosclerosis Reports, 2004Flavonoids are polyphenolic compounds found in fruits, vegetables, and beverages derived from plants. Foods thought historically by many societies to have healing properties--cocoa, red wine, and tea--are particularly rich in flavonoids.
